MARGAO: This year, the feast of St Francis Xavier, popularly called as Goencho Saib will be celebrated on December 4 this year at Old Goa, as the Advent season begins on December 3, which falls on a Sunday.
“The liturgical year, which begins on the first Sunday of Advent, is an important day given to Lord Jesus. A saint’s feast that falls on that particular Sunday is always taken to the next day. Accordingly, the feast of St Francis Xavier will be celebrated on December 4,” said Rector of the Basilica of Bom Jesus Fr Patricio Fernandes, in a comment given to the media.
It should be noted that the annual novena and feast attract thousands of devotees and pilgrims, who gather around the Basilica of Bom Jesus for this spiritual occasion. The novenas will begin on Saturday, November 25. Daily masses will be held at 6 am, 7.15 am, 8.30 am, 9.45 am, 11 am, 3.30 pm, 5 pm, and 6.15 pm (English). The feast day masses will be at 3.45 am, 5 am, 6.15 am, 7.30 am, 8.45 am, 10.30 am (Main feast mass), 1 pm, 2 pm, 3 pm, 4 pm, 5 pm, and 6 pm (English).
Furthermore, the Maddi mass (volunteer’s mass) before the novenas will be held on November 24 at 6 pm.
The inter-religious meet will take place on November 30, Thursday, at 10 am, followed by a mass at 12 pm in Konkani.”
